61The Green Beret Foundation (GBF) is a highly respected nonprofit organization dedicated to serving U.S. Army Special Forces Soldiers, their families, caregivers, and surviving loved ones. Since its founding in 2009, the Foundation has worked tirelessly to provide direct assistance, advocacy, and specialized programs tailored to meet the unique needs of the Green Beret community. Headquartered in Southern Pines, North Carolina, the Green Beret Foundation embodies the values of honor, integrity, and resilience, ensuring that America’s elite warriors and their families receive the care and support they have rightfully earned.
The Foundation was established by Aaron Anderson, a Special Forces Soldier who was wounded in combat and identified a significant lack of immediate and ongoing care for his fellow Green Berets. His personal experience led to the creation of an organization that bridges critical gaps left by existing systems. From the beginning, the Green Beret Foundation has been dedicated to alleviating the burden on Soldiers and their families facing hardship, while equipping them with the tools for healing and long-term stability. Over the years, the Foundation has grown to become a trusted partner for thousands within the Special Forces community, offering a wide range of programs focused on recovery, transition, and family resilience.
Central to GBF’s mission is its dedication to improving the overall health and wellness of Green Berets and their families. The Foundation supplements traditional military and veteran healthcare with evidence-based therapies, including Stellate Ganglion Block treatments for post-traumatic stress disorder, infrared light therapy, and advanced recovery systems designed to reduce inflammation, support rehabilitation, and enhance physical and emotional well-being. Within this effort, Task Force Tatanka plays an essential role by promoting psychological health and resilience through peer support, family engagement, and performance-based wellness practices tailored to the demands of Special Forces life.
In addition to its health initiatives, the Foundation offers immediate financial relief through its Casualty Support program, assisting families with managing travel, lodging, and emergency expenses during times of injury or crisis. GBF also stands firmly with Gold Star families and survivors, providing long-term advocacy and emotional support that honors their loved ones’ sacrifices. The Next Ridgeline program supports Green Berets transitioning to civilian life, providing career preparation, scholarships, and guidance for achieving post-military success. Veteran Services Officers within the Foundation further strengthen this mission by helping Soldiers and their families access VA benefits, securing millions of dollars in monthly support.
The Foundation also recognizes the vital role of families through initiatives such as the Steel Mags program and educational scholarships for spouses and children. Since its inception, the Green Beret Foundation has provided over $28 million in direct assistance and supported more than 26,000 families. With 84 percent of every dollar going directly to its programs, the Foundation maintains a strong record of transparency and fiscal responsibility, earning top ratings for its impact.
